Project Overview
Chris Wowk
MANE 6960
Wear Testing of Self-Lubricated
Bearing Materials
• Army Corps of Engineers tested ~10 PTFE based selflubricating bearing materials under high load, low speed
oscillating conditions for 120 hrs (approximately equivalent to
14 years of service life)
• Testing reported depth of wear per 100 hours of testing
• Project will calculate the wear coefficients of the materials
using Archard’s Law

Other PTFE Wear Testing
• Wear coefficients calculated from COE testing
will be compared to other determined wear
coefficients for similar materials
• LSU testing – pin on disk testing of PTFE based
composites
• Gdansk University testing – planar sliding of
commercial PTFE based bearing materials
Edge Loading of Bearings
• Misalignment of bearings can lead to a large
reduction in contact area
• COE simulated misalignment in their testing
• Compared test results to ABAQUS model that
determines contact area
